Final Revision Tips to Crack PTET 2026: The Vardhman Mahaveer Open University, Kota, conducted the Pre-Teacher Education Test (PTET) 2026 on June 14, 2026. The PTET exam is a platform for candidates who want to pursue a B.Ed. course from Rajasthan. PTET 2026 Highlights

Particulars

Details

Exam Name

Rajasthan PTET 2026

Conducting Body

VMOU Kota

Exam Date

June 14, 2026

Exam Mode

Offline (Pen and Paper)

Courses Offered

2-Year B.Ed, BA B.Ed, BSc B.Ed

Exam Duration

3 Hours

Q:   What is the full-form of PTET?
A: 

PTET stands for Pre-teacher Education Test conducted in Rajasthan. It is held for candidates who wish to get admission in 2-year BEd and 4-years integrated programs for colleges across the state.

Q:   Is PTET conducted twice a year?
A: 

No, PTET is conducted once a year only. Candidates must apply and appear for the exam within that cycle to be eligible for admission in that academic session.

Q:   What is the duration of the PTET exam?
A: 

The total duration of the PTET exam is 3 hours. Candidates must complete all questions within this time.

PTET Exam Pattern 2026

From the following table, candidates can find exam pattern of PTET exam. The pattern consists of the sections and several questions asked in the exam, along with the marks.

Sections

Questions

Duration

Mental Ability

50

3 hours

Teaching Attitude & Aptitude Test

50

General Awareness

50

Language Proficiency (Hindi or English)

50

Total

200

PTET Syllabus 2026

The syllabus of the PTET 2026 is prescribed by the exam conducting authority, and the question paper will have questions based on the syllabus. Check here the syllabus of the PTET 2026 exam.

Sections 

PTET Syllabus 

Mental Ability 

  • Reasoning 
  • Imagination 
  • Judgment & Decision Making 
  • Creative Thinking
    Generalization 
  • Drawing inferences, etc. 

Teaching Attitude & Aptitude Test 

  • Social Maturity 
  • Leadership 
  • Professional Commitment 
  • Interpersonal Relations 
  • Communication 
  • Awareness etc.  

General Awareness 

  • Current Affairs (National & International) 
  • Indian History & Culture 
  • India and Its Natural Resources 
  • Great Indian Personalities (Past and Present) 
  • Environmental Awareness 
  • Knowledge about Rajasthan, etc.  

Language Proficiency (Hindi or English) 

  • Vocabulary 
  • Functional Grammar 
  • Sentence Structures 
  • Comprehension etc.

Rajasthan PTET Exam Preparation Plan

Start by Solidifying Your Basics

  • To do the same, candidates are advised to revise the important concepts in Mental Ability (coding-decoding, series, analogies, puzzles).
  • Cover General Awareness (history, Indian polity, geography, and current affairs).
  • Focus on basic grammar rules, comprehension, and vocabulary for the Language section.
  • Follow a timetable and allot at least 3-4 hours daily for revision practising mock tests and solving past year question papers.

Revision and Practice are the key to success

  • Solve previous years' question papers and attempt mock tests regularly to improve familiarity with the exam pattern and question types.
  • Prepare concise one-page revision notes covering important topics such as teaching philosophies, educational concepts, and general awareness. Keep these notes handy and revise them whenever you get free time.
  • Practice Hindi and English language questions, especially error detection, sentence correction, grammar rules, and sentence improvement exercises.
  • Use a timer while solving mock tests and practice papers. This will help improve your speed, time management skills, and overall question-solving efficiency.
  • Pay special attention to the Teaching Aptitude section, as it is often considered one of the highest-scoring areas of the exam. Revise topics such as classroom management, child development, learning theories, and teaching methodologies.
  • Revise important static GK topics and stay updated with recent current affairs. Make short notes of significant events for quick revision.
  • Analyse your mock test performance carefully. Identify recurring mistakes, work on weak areas, and ensure that the same errors are not repeated in subsequent tests.
  • Avoid starting any new topics during the final stage of preparation. Focus only on revising concepts you have already studied and strengthening your existing knowledge.

General Tips for Students Preparing for the PTET 2026

  • Stay Consistent and make a realistic timetable and stick to it.
  • Avoid passive reading, write, quiz yourself, and teach concepts to others. If you can’t find anyone, talk in front of the mirror to reinforce what you have already read.
    Follow credible sources for daily current affairs, especially those of Rajasthan and India.
  • Take short breaks in between study sessions to avoid burnout.
  • Eat right, sleep 7–8 hours daily, and stay hydrated. Falling ill is the last thing an aspirant will ever want

PTET Last-Minute Do’s & Don’ts

Do’s:

  • Revise from your notes.
  • Keep your hall ticket and ID proof ready once released. If it is possible, check the route of the exam centre and adjust as per the traffic.
  • Stay confident and calm while attempting the questions.

Don’ts:

  • Don’t start any new topics during this period, as it will only add to the confusion.
  • Don’t compare your PTET preparation with others. It often leads to confusion and disappointment
  • Avoid late-night studying one day before the exam.
